环境:Visual Studio 2015 RTM。 (我没有尝试旧版本。) 最近,我一直在debugging一些Noda Time代码,我注意到当我有一个types为NodaTime.Instant的本地variables(Noda Time中的一个中心structtypes)时,“Locals”和“监视”窗口似乎不会调用其ToString()覆盖。 如果我在监视窗口中显式地调用ToString() ,我会看到适当的表示,但是我只看到: variableName {NodaTime.Instant} 这不是很有用。 如果我改变override来返回一个常量string,那么这个string就会显示在debugging器中,所以很明显它能够提取它的存在 – 它只是不想在“normal”状态下使用它。 我决定在一个小小的演示应用程序中重现这一点,下面是我想到的。 (请注意,在这篇文章的早期版本中, DemoStruct是一个类, DemoStruct根本不存在 – 我的错,但它解释了一些现在看起来很奇怪的评论…) using System; using System.Diagnostics; using System.Threading; public struct DemoStruct { public string Name { get; } public DemoStruct(string name) { Name = name; } public override string ToString() { Thread.Sleep(1000); // Vary this […]
问题 在Visual Studio 2015中,使用bower时,我的软件包在防火墙后面恢复失败,出现类似如下的错误: ECMDERR无法执行“git ls-remote –tags – heads git://github.com/jzaefferer/jquery-validation.git”,退出代码#-532462766 我已经更新了我的gitconfiguration使用http而不是git。 当我从命令行运行时,命令成功: 但Visual Studio或其组件之一似乎是使用git而不是http 。 背景和第一次尝试解决 使用Visual Studio 2015和Bower进行包pipe理。 当它不在防火墙后面时,它很好用,但是在防火墙后面,我不能使用git://协议。 解决scheme – 在许多其他地方logging在SO( 例子 ),是运行: git config –global url."http://".insteadOf git:// 我做到了,现在我的git config -l看起来像: ore.symlinks=false core.autocrlf=true color.diff=auto color.status=auto color.branch=auto color.interactive=true pack.packsizelimit=2g help.format=html http.sslcainfo=/bin/curl-ca-bundle.crt sendemail.smtpserver=/bin/msmtp.exe diff.astextplain.textconv=astextplain rebase.autosquash=true user.name=Sean Killeen user.email=SeanKilleen@gmail.com url.http://.insteadof=git:// 但是,尽pipe如此,Visual Studio / npm不尊重我的configuration,或者使用旧的caching版本。 第二次尝试解决 根据npm问题上的这个线程 […]
我为Visual Studio Ultimate CTP 6下载了完整的ISO。安装程序达到了大约90%的标准,通过进度条进行测量,然后卡在那里。 Superfetch,反恶意软件保护和其他后台进程经常发生,但进度条仍然死机。 最终后台任务活动在20分钟后平息,但进度条仍然不会退步。 便利贴:打开记事本窗口并定位其左边缘,以便完美地标记进度条的当前位置。 如果进度条在大约一个小时内没有移过记事本窗口的左边缘,则可能卡住了。
我安装了Visual Studio 2015专业版,我的电脑规格是Intel i7-3770 CPU 3.40 GHz,8 GB RAM和Windows 7 Enterprise 64位。 我想将我的项目升级到Visual Studio 2005 .NET 2.0中编写的.NET 4.6,但是我有一个严重的速度问题。 在Visual Studio 2015中打开我的项目(巨大的项目)之后,它变得疯狂了。 build设,debugging,打开菜单太慢了。 有时我收到“没有回应”的信息。 是关于Windows 7还是可以给我关于我的速度问题的任何意见?
我花了大约7个小时试图通过反复试验来弄清楚这一点。 我见过的所有在线例子都不起作用,或者不适用,或者只显示我寻找的一半。 下面是我所要求的:1.一个在MYSQL中使用一个IN参数和一个OUT参数的简单存储过程的例子。 2.一个函数的例子(真的很重要,导致在线例子有时没有工作…)从Visual Studio调用,使用C#。 文本调用或存储过程命令types工作。 3. AddWithValue已被弃用。 4.我希望看到out参数实际上工作。 如果MYSQL和visual studio不可能这样做,那也不错。 对于这个特定的例子,MYSQL文档不够彻底。 而且,请不要使用Visual Studio或C#仇恨。 提前致谢! 🙂 编辑: 这是我迄今为止设法做到的,它不工作! MYSQL方面,使用HeidiSQL: CREATE DEFINER=`root`@`localhost` PROCEDURE `login`(IN `stuff` VARCHAR(50), IN `pass` VARCHAR(50), OUT `param3` INT) LANGUAGE SQL NOT DETERMINISTIC CONTAINS SQL SQL SECURITY DEFINER COMMENT '' BEGIN set param3 = 0; set param3 = (select count(*) from users where […]
我遇到同样的问题,其他人在安装Visual Studio 2015时使用更新1.它在Team Explorer安装上失败,据我所知它是由这个问题中概述的同样的错误( 多个错误安装Visual Studio 2015社区版 )。 我已经尝试了这个问题的答案中解释的步骤,包括俄语的答案。 但是,安装仍然在同一时间失败。 我现在正在思考,想出点想法。 谁能帮忙?
我创build空白xamarin的android项目,而无需添加任何代码,当我debugging这个项目debugging没有问题,但是当我运行的应用程序与视觉工作室模拟器的android模拟器运行,但没有启动我的应用程序和部署失败,不显示我错误 为什么? 请帮帮我
当我在Microsoft Visual Studio 2015 Update 2中debugging我的应用程序时,我打开一个自定义wpf对话框,在黑色方块中获得一些额外的debugging选项。 看图像打击。 我如何禁用? 这第一个图标说“去活视觉树”。 第二个图标显示“启用select”。 第三个图标显示“Display Layout Adorners”。
如何在Visual Studio 2015中使用ES2015代码获得正确的语法突出显示? 它工作正常,如果我删除import和export关键字: 我刚刚更新到Visual Studio 2015年企业更新1,但仍然保持不变。
问题 我安装了Visual Studio 2015 RC,并安装了Visual Studio 2015 RTM。 我在网上找不到任何说你不能这样做的东西。 我不知道这是否与问题有关。 不幸的是,当我重新启动VS 2015 RTM后第一次popup消息框: “Microsoft.VisualStudio.Editor.Implementation.EditorPackage”包没有正确加载“ 也: XamarinShellPackage TestWindowPackage NuGetPackage ErrorListPackage 我怎样才能解决这个错误? 日志 它说要查看ActivityLog.xml 。 我无法findMicrosoft.VisualStudio.Editor.Implementation.EditorPackage。 但是对于XamarinShellPackage来说, <entry> <record>339</record> <time>2015/07/21 13:01:54.011</time> <type>Error</type> <source>VisualStudio</source> <description>SetSite failed for package [XamarinShellPackage]</description> <guid>{2D510815-1C4E-4210-BD82-3D9D2C56C140}</guid> <hr>80070057 – E_INVALIDARG</hr> <errorinfo>'providers' cannot contain a null (Nothing in Visual Basic) element. Parameter name: providers</errorinfo> </entry> <entry> […]